The Hazlewood
Named for Grady Hazlewood, a former member of the Texas Senate who was a savvy and popular country lawyer adept at procuring the passage of his bills. The Hazlewood Act has allowed for tuition waivers at public universities in Texas since its inception. The act was passed after World War II and allows for the exemption of tuition fees, fees, course material and correspondence courses up to 150 semester hours.
The Hazlewood program is an enormous financial burden for universities that are having to pay for increasing costs and lower state support. In fact, UT System administrators expect to lose $38.8 million in Hazlewood waivers this year, a significant part of the university's $1.4 billion budget.
You must meet certain requirements to be eligible for this benefit. You must have served with honor in the U.S. Armed Forces, Texas National Guard or both. You must possess Texas residency either during the time you served in the military, or prior to applying for an exemption. You must be a college student pursuing an academic degree and be enrolled at minimum 50% of the time.
Log into the Texas Veterans Commission’s online Hazlewood Student Database if you previously participated in Hazlewood at another institution. You must keep an eye on your hours and fill out an Hazlewood application each semester prior to the beginning of classes at Hill College.
